Types of 60mm blower fan 5vs

A 60mm blower fan 5v is a powerful cooling device with a small footprint capable of moving a large volume of air. It works by drawing air from the surrounding environment and blow it in a straight line, perpendicular to the intake direction. Blower fans are available in many sizes. The 60mm model is relatively common.

Although working on the same premise, the 60mm blower fans can be separated into two main categories:

  • AC Blower Fan: An AC blower fan functions when connected to an alternating current. Common applications of AC blower fans include household appliances like freezers, refrigerators, air conditioners, space heaters, and cooling ovens.
  • DC Blower Fan: A DC blower fan works when direct current powers it. Due to the ease of mass manufacturing, variable-speed control function, and programmable controllers within an appliance, 5V DC blower fans are common in small electronics like smartphones, tablets, and laptops. Because of its low power consumption and quiet operation, a small 60mm DC blower fan is ideal for circuitry and environmental control in smart devices.

Specification and maintenance of a 60mm blower fan 5V

The specifications of a 60mm blower fan will determine the performance capabilities of the unit. When selecting a blower, it's always best to choose one that meets the specific needs of the application. Below are some common specifications to consider when selecting a 60mm blower fan, as well as their maintenance requirements.

  • Voltage

    Every blower fan is designed to work with a specific voltage. Operating a fan at the wrong voltage can damage the unit or lead to subpar performance. Therefore, it's important to choose a blower whose voltage rating matches the intended application. For instance, in portable devices, a 60mm blower fan 5v is commonly used. Operating a fan at its designed voltage enables optimal performance with a balanced airflow and pressure.

  • Speed

    A blower fan's speed is indicated in revolutions per minute (RPM). Higher speeds usually result in greater airflow. However, some applications may require lower speeds to reduce noise levels. For instance, the speed of a 60mm blower can range from 2000 to 6000 RPM. Regardless of the speed, the blower fan should be maintained to enable it to operate efficiently. The maintenance of the fan is crucial, especially when it's operating at high speeds, as this can lead to the accumulation of debris and dirt that can affect its performance. To maintain the fan, users should regularly inspect it for any signs of damage. If they notice any, it's important to address those issues immediately to prevent more damage from occurring. Another maintenance tip is to keep the surroundings of the fan clean. This prevents dirt from getting into it. Also, users should make a habit of lubricating the moving parts of the fan to reduce friction and ensure smooth operation. If the fan operates at high speeds, implementing controls to regulate its speed is essential. This is to protect the fan from overheating.

  • Airflow

    Airflow measured in CFM (cubic feet per minute) indicates the volume of air the blower fan moves per minute. The higher the CFM, the higher the airflow. The performance of a 60mm blower is significantly affected by dust and debris buildup. Regular cleaning of the fan's exterior and intake area is important to prevent this buildup. Only a clean blower fan can perform at its maximum airflow. Also, users should install the fan in a way that allows full access to the intake and exhaust areas. When replacing a 60mm fan, consider another one with a similar placement to avoid blocking any airflow pathways. Once a fan is installed, don't block its intake and exhaust areas. Doing this can create a buildup of dust and debris that can affect its performance.

How to choose a 60mm blower fan

There are many 60mm blower fans available for wholesalers to choose from. When selecting a specific model or type, it is important to consider various factors to ensure a good purchase.

  • Application Suitability

    It is important to choose a blower fan that is suitable for the intended application. Consider the factors that can impact the performance of the fan, such as the air volume and pressure needed for the equipment. For example, a printer cooling blower fan will differ from a computer one. Check the fan's dimension to ensure a proper fit. Consider distinct mounting options, such as axial or rack mounting.

  • Operating Environment

    If the 60mm blower fan will be used in an extreme environment, choose one that can handle such conditions. In this case, pick a blower fan with an IP rating that can withstand dust or moisture. It is also important to select a model that can withstand high or low temperatures. If the fan will be operating for a long time without interruptions, consider a model with a high-speed and durable performance to minimize downtime.

  • Noise Level

    Consider the blower fan's noise ratings in decibels (dB). If the operating noise level is a concern, choose a model with a lower noise level. The choice of the housing material can affect the noise level of the fan. Use materials with high damping properties to lower the noise level further.

  • Energy Efficiency

    When selecting a 60mm blower fan, consider its energy consumption. Opt for models with high airflow-per-watt efficiency to utilize the power usage fully. Fans with brushless DC motors offer better energy efficiency compared to those with brushed DC motors.

  • Reliability and Performance

    Selecting a blower fan with dependable performance is important. Choose fans that have been tested for performance and included in the manufacturer's reliability records. Opt for fans with built-in thermal protection to prevent overheating. Consider the fan's mean time before failure (MTBF), which indicates the lifespan of the fan under normal operating conditions.

  • Cost and Value

    Consider the total cost of operating the 60mm blower fan, such as energy usage and maintenance. If the fan will be used for long periods, select a model that offers good performance but at a reasonable cost.
